The Role

Reporting to the Tax Manager, you'll be a key player in corporate tax compliance and reporting while gaining exposure to various advisory projects. This role also offers opportunities to broaden your expertise across diverse tax matters.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Corporate Tax & Reporting - Prepare corporate tax computations and group external reports.
  • Financial & Business Planning - Assist with regulatory planning and company business strategies.
  • Strategic Tax Advisory - Collaborate with senior tax and legal teams on key transactions.
  • Tax Forecasting - Conduct tax modelling, profit/loss forecasting, and tax liability estimations.
  • Technology & Process Improvement - Support system integrations and implementation of tax technology solutions.
  • Ad-Hoc Tax Advisory - Provide expert guidance on a range of tax-related matters.
  • Employment Tax Support - Assist with employment tax queries (training available if needed).
  • Tax Risk & Governance - Support compliance, governance, and SAO-related activities.

What We're Looking For

  • Qualified Tax Professional - ACA, ACCA, and/or CTA certified.
  • Corporate Tax Expertise - At least one year of post-qualification experience in UK corporate tax.
  • Technical Knowledge - Strong understanding of UK tax regulations, capital allowances, and IFRS tax accounting.
  • Tech-Savvy Approach - Proficient in Excel and eager to explore tax technology solutions.

Why Join Us?

  • Competitive Salary & Bonus - Up to 10.5% performance-based bonus.
  • Generous Annual Leave - 26 days (rising to 30 with service) + 8 bank holidays.
  • Top-Tier Pension Scheme - Up to 14% employer contribution.
  • Comprehensive Healthcare Plan - Prioritising your well-being.
  • Professional Development & Training - Continuous learning and career progression opportunities.
